Men’s and Women’s Lacrosse Added for 2020-’21

Madison, Wis. (July 2, 2019) - In what has already been an exciting summer for the Athletics Department at Edgewood College, the Eagles added to that excitement with the addition of two more sports, announced Today. Edgewood College will be add both Men's and Women's Lacrosse to their varsity sports lineup, beginning during the 2020-21 academic year.

Edgewood College’s First Pitch Competition concluded

The first social impact pitch competition at Edgewood College – a new component of Edgewood Engaged – saw the project ‘Her Empowerment Race Zone’ (HERZ) awarded first place. The brainchild of Natasha Sichula, a senior majoring in Cytotechnology, HERZ advocates for distribution of free sanitary care packages to girls in her hometown of Mufulira, Zambia.

Summer Scholars Program Launched at Edgewood College

Madison, Wis. (April 2, 2019) – Edgewood College is pleased to announce the launch of the Summer Scholars program. This unique academic opportunity is designed for students entering sixth grade in the fall of 2019. Scholars will engage in experiences that build their academic skills. The weeklong program runs from 8:00 am – 4:00 pm, July 15 – 19, 2019, on the campus of Edgewood College.​
